Verovian Healthcare Recruitment Agency is seeking a compassionate and highly skilled Registered Nurse (RN) to join the Pediatric Intensive Care Unit (PICU) in Seattle, Washington.

As a PICU RN, you will provide critical care to infants, children, and adolescents with life-threatening conditions. You will coll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to deliver exceptional care and support to both patients and their families during challenging times.

Job specification
  • Provide advanced nursing care to pediatric patients with severe and complex medical conditions, including respiratory failure, sepsis, trauma, and post-operative care following major surgeries.
  • Perform continuous assessments of patients, closely monitoring vital signs, neurological status, and other critical indicators to detect and respond to changes in condition promptly.
  • Administer medications, blood products, and advanced therapies as prescribed, following strict protocols and ensuring patient safety.
  • Offer emotional support and education to families, helping them understand their child's condition, treatment plan, and care needs, and involving them in the decision-making process.
  • Work closely with pediatric intensivists, surgeons, respiratory therapists, and other healthcare professionals to develop and implement individualized care plans that meet the unique needs of each patient.
  • Act quickly and efficiently in emergencies, using advanced life support skills to stabilize critically ill patients.
  • Accurately document all aspects of patient care, including assessments, interventions, and outcomes, in compliance with hospital policies and regulatory standards.
  • Operate and troubleshoot complex medical equipment such as ventilators, ECMO machines, and infusion pumps, ensuring their proper use and maintenance.
  • Participate in quality improvement initiatives and adhere to infection control and safety protocols to maintain the highest standard of care in the PICU.
Candidate requirements
  • Bachelor's degree in Nursing (BSN) is required.
  • Current Registered Nurse (RN) license in Washington.
  • Minimum of 2 years of experience in a pediatric or intensive care setting is required; PICU experience is preferred.
  • BLS and PALS (Pediatric Advanced Life Support) certifications are required; CCRN (Critical Care Registered Nurse) certifications are preferred.
  • Strong clinical and critical thinking skills, excellent communication and teamwork abilities, and a deep commitment to providing compassionate care to pediatric patients and their families.
